Living in Cobham And Downside
Cobham and Downside, located in the picturesque Elmbridge borough, offers a delightful blend of suburban tranquility and vibrant community life. Surrounded by beautiful countryside, the area is known for its stunning green spaces, including the scenic Cobham Common and the nearby Painshill Park, which provides a perfect escape for nature enthusiasts and families alike.
The village atmosphere is complemented by a range of independent shops, quaint cafes, and local restaurants, fostering a strong sense of community. Cobham and Downside also boast excellent transport links, making it an attractive option for commuters who wish to enjoy the serenity of village life while still being within easy reach of London. With its rich history and charming architecture, this area offers a unique living experience in Surrey.
